Estimator

Planned Maintenance, FRA, Cladding Remediation - Property Services

Up to £85000 Plus Package

Our Client, a tier one contractor with a great reputation, are looking for an experienced Estimator with planned maintenance experience in the Social Housing sector.

As a business, they deliver planned maintenance, fire safety, retrofit and cladding re mediation schemes across London & South East Of England for local authorities and housing associations. This role would be to join their pre construction team, working hand in hand with the bids team in securing new contracts & projects.

They currently turnover £50m plus and they are looking to grow this further. They see this role as pivotal in the next stages of their companies development and they will offer you the opportunity to progress and build your own team in the future should you perform well.

Day to Day Responsibilities;

• Responsible for the financial preparation of bids for the business

• Work in partnership with the bid team throughout the pre-construction and bid process

• Ensure bids are risk assessed and reported to the directors

• Prepare submissions in the agreed format consistent with the company branding

• Present submissions to the directors for review

• Manage handover of successful bids to the delivery team

• Provide feedback and responses for the delivery team to assist with any post tender queries

• Preparing the cost components of the proposal, including understanding of the task, planning, assessing past performance and personnel in partnership with the management team

• Attend meetings with Client, Designers, Project Managers and relevant stakeholders as required

• Attend Site Visits as required • Manage the supply chain to ensure competitive quotes are obtained

• Ensure supply chain quotes are checked to ensure compliance with the tender documents

• Manage tender clarifications throughout the bid process

• Measuring & ‘Taking-Off' quantities from drawings
